Why is this important?
May 8 the Honolulu City Council will take a final vote on Bill 85 to enforce zoning laws and shut down illegal vacation rentals. They will also take a final vote on Bill 89 which has the same enforcement measures but also gives out permits to a set percentage of the houses in each development district to do vacation rentals in a home with a home owner tax exemption. Those who win the lottery and get the permits will get first dibs on renewing every two years, creating a priveleged group who will benefit financially while the property values and quality of life of their neighbors goes down. We need proven enforcement first with Bill 85 before considering additional permits in residential zones.
